    Ghanaian chart-topper, Black Sherif, has made history by becoming the most exported Ghanaian artiste for the first half of 2025.

    According to a list released by Spotify, 13 out of 15 tracks from his sophomore album, “Iron Boy,” made it to Spotify’s Global Impact list of most exported Ghanaian songs for the first half of 2025, claiming 15 of the top 19 spots.

    This marks an exceptional breakthrough, especially as “Iron Boy” becomes the first Ghanaian album to spend two weeks in the Apple Music Top 50 in the USA and debut at no 7 on Spotify’s Global Album Debut Charts.

    The record-setting release also crossed 60 million Spotify streams and secured #10 on Billboard’s US World Albums chart.

    Since 2022, Black Sherif has been the most streamed Ghanaian artiste on Spotify after the release of his debut album, “The Villain I Never Was” which was released in October 2022.

    The album itself achieved respectable success, debuting at #12 on Billboard’s World Albums and scoring a #1 hit in Nigeria with “Kwaku the Traveller”.

    However, “Iron Boy” has far outpaced its predecessor in both streaming volume and global penetration, solidifying Black Sherif as one of the most formidable artistes in the country.
